This commit adds interpolation from the point domain to the spline domain and the other way around. Before this, spline domain attributes were basically useless, but now they are quite helpful as a way to use a shared value in a contiguous group of points. I implementented a special virtual array for the spline to points conversion, so that conversion should be close to the ideal performance level, but there are a few ways we could optimize the point to spline conversion in the future: - Use a function virtual array to mix the point values for each spline on demand. - Implement a special case for when the input virtual array is one of the virtual arrays from the spline point attributes. In other words, decrease curve attribute access overhead. Differential Revision: https://developer.blender.org/D11376

Blender is the free and open source 3D creation suite. It supports the entirety of the 3D pipeline-modeling, rigging, animation, simulation, rendering, compositing, motion tracking and video editing.

Blender as a whole is licensed under the GNU General Public License, Version 3. Individual files may have a different, but compatible license.
See blender.org/about/license for details.
